1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a measure of the change of velocity of a moving object?
Back
acceleration
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
If the velocity vector and acceleration vectors are moving in the same direction, what happens to the speed?
Back
speed will increase.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Which is not an example of acceleration? Options: Driving at a constant speed, A bat hitting a ball, Throwing a football, Kicking a soccer ball
Back
Driving at a constant speed
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
The force that a person or thing applies to an object
Back
applied forces
